annelidous

C2+ Topic:Animals
US /əˈnelɪdəs/ UK /əˈnelɪdəs/
adj

Meanings

  1. 1
    adj

    relating to or resembling annelids, the segmented worms that include earthworms and leeches

    The mud was disturbed by an annelidous animal with a visibly segmented body.

Etymology

Formed from annelid + -ous. Annelid came through French annelide from New Latin annellus, 'small ring,' ultimately from Latin anulus, 'ring,' referring to the ringlike body segments of these worms.
